CONTENU
|
I. Herbrew illuminated manuscripts of the Lake Constance Region The Biblical codex ; Ashkenazi and Latin Bibles ; The Pentateuch ; The mahzor and books for the divine office ; Formation and variation of the Mahzor and the Pentateuch ; The mahzor, the Siddur and Sefer mizvot qatan -- II. Structure, liturgy, interpretation : the decoration programmes: Structure ; Liturgy ; Actual and symbolic liturgical calendars ; Illustration as interpretation -- III. A Jewish-Christian visual dialogue. 1. Pesah/Easter, Shavuot/Pentecost : a dual realm ; 2. Solomon, the song of songs and the song of the hybrids ; 3. Holy and profane : animals, hybrids & Rabbi Meir of Rothenburg ; 4. Reality and fantasy : nobility in a Jewish context -- IV. The urban workshop : the Hebrew school of illumination and the gradual of St. Katharinenthal: Common stylistic features : The evolution of style ; The sources of style ; The workshop : the Hebrew group and the gradual of St. Katharinenthal -- V. Hayyim : a Jewish scribe in a Christian workshop: The French connection ; Micrography and illumination ; Writing and illuminating -- VI. Conclusion: The Jewish population of the Lake Constance region ; The Jews, the Emperor, and the city ; The patrons ; Relations between Jews and Christians.
